    def _compute_cascade_attn_prefix_len(
        self,
        num_scheduled_tokens: np.ndarray,
        num_common_prefix_blocks: int,
797
798
        kv_cache_spec: KVCacheSpec,
        attn_metadata_builder: AttentionMetadataBuilder,
799
800
801
802
803
804
805
806
807
808
809
810
811
812
813
814
815
816
    ) -> int:
        """Compute the length of the common prefix for cascade attention.

        NOTE(woosuk): The common prefix length returned by this function
        represents the length used specifically for cascade attention, not the
        actual number of tokens shared between requests. When cascade attention
        is disabled (use_cascade=False), this function returns 0 even if
        requests share common tokens. Additionally, the common prefix length is
        truncated to a multiple of the block size and may be further truncated
        due to implementation details explained below.

        Args:
            num_scheduled_tokens: Number of tokens scheduled per request.
            num_common_prefix_blocks: Number of shared KV cache blocks.

        Returns:
            int: Length of common prefix in tokens.
        """
817
        common_prefix_len = num_common_prefix_blocks * kv_cache_spec.block_size
818
819
820
821
822
823
824
825
826
827
828
829
830
831
832
833
834
835
836
837
838
839
840
841
842
843
844
845
846
847
848
849
850
851
852
853
854
        if common_prefix_len == 0:
            # Common case.
            return 0

        # NOTE(woosuk): Cascade attention uses two attention kernels: one
        # for the common prefix and the other for the rest. For the first
        # kernel, we concatenate all the query tokens (possibly from
        # different requests) and treat them as if they are from the same
        # request. Then, we use bi-directional attention to process the
        # common prefix in the KV cache. Importantly, this means that the
        # first kernel does not do any masking.

        # Consider the following example:
        # Request 1's input query: [D, E, X]
        # Request 1's kv cache: [A, B, C, D, E, X]
        # Request 1's num_computed_tokens: 3 (i.e., [A, B, C])
        # Request 2's input query: [E, Y]
        # Request 2's kv cache: [A, B, C, D, E, Y]
        # Request 2's num_computed_tokens: 4 (i.e., [A, B, C, D])

        # If we use [A, B, C, D, E] as the common prefix, then the
        # first kernel will compute the bi-directional attention between
        # input query [D, E, X, E, Y] and common prefix [A, B, C, D, E].
        # However, this is wrong because D in Request 1 should not attend to
        # E in the common prefix (i.e., we need masking).
        # To avoid this, [A, B, C, D] should be the common prefix.
        # That is, the common prefix should be capped by the minimum
        # num_computed_tokens among the requests, and plus one to include
        # the first token of the query.

        # In practice, we use [A, B, C] as the common prefix, instead of
        # [A, B, C, D] (i.e., the common prefix is capped by the minimum
        # num_computed_tokens, without plus one).
        # This is because of an implementation detail: We want to always
        # use two kernels for cascade attention. Let's imagine:
        # Request 3's input query: [D]
        # Request 3's kv cache: [A, B, C, D]
855
        # Request 3's num_computed_tokens: 3 (i.e., [A, B, C])
856
857
858
859
860
861
862
863
864
865
        # If we use [A, B, C, D] as the common prefix for Request 1-3,
        # then Request 3 will be processed only by the first kernel,
        # and the second kernel will get an empty input. While this is not
        # a fundamental problem, our current implementation does not support
        # this case.
        num_reqs = len(num_scheduled_tokens)
        common_prefix_len = min(
            common_prefix_len,
            self.input_batch.num_computed_tokens_cpu[:num_reqs].min())
        # common_prefix_len should be a multiple of the block size.
866
867
868
869
870
        common_prefix_len = (common_prefix_len // kv_cache_spec.block_size *
                             kv_cache_spec.block_size)
        use_sliding_window = (isinstance(kv_cache_spec, SlidingWindowSpec) or
                              (isinstance(kv_cache_spec, FullAttentionSpec)
                               and kv_cache_spec.sliding_window is not None))
871
872
873
874
        use_local_attention = (
            isinstance(kv_cache_spec, ChunkedLocalAttentionSpec)
            or (isinstance(kv_cache_spec, FullAttentionSpec)
                and kv_cache_spec.attention_chunk_size is not None))
875
876
        assert isinstance(kv_cache_spec, AttentionSpec)
        use_cascade = attn_metadata_builder.use_cascade_attention(
877
878
879
            common_prefix_len=common_prefix_len,
            query_lens=num_scheduled_tokens,
            num_query_heads=self.num_query_heads,
880
            num_kv_heads=kv_cache_spec.num_kv_heads,
881
            use_alibi=self.use_alibi,
882
            use_sliding_window=use_sliding_window,
883
            use_local_attention=use_local_attention,
884
885
886
887
            num_sms=self.num_sms,
        )
        return common_prefix_len if use_cascade else 0
